Latest Patents
Denison holds a patent for a "Selective deposition modeling system and method." This invention involves a system and associated method for forming three-dimensional objects under computer control. The process utilizes a material that can be rendered flowable and dispensed layer by layer. Each layer solidifies or transforms physically upon being dispensed, allowing for the formation of successive cross-sections. The dispensing process is repeated, enabling the layers to adhere to one another and ultimately create the final object.
Career Highlights
Denison is currently employed at 3D Systems, Inc., a leading company in the 3D printing industry. His work there has allowed him to explore and develop advanced technologies that enhance the capabilities of additive manufacturing.
Collaborations
Throughout his career, Denison has collaborated with notable colleagues, including Jeffrey S. Thayer and Thomas A. Almquist. These partnerships have contributed to the advancement of innovative solutions in the field.
